2-[4-(2-Hydroxyethyl)-1-piperazinyl]ethanesulfonic acid (HEPES) is a chemical compound commonly used as a buffering agent in cell culture and biochemical applications. It is a zwitterionic Good's buffer that helps maintain a stable pH environment in aqueous solutions. HEPES is highly soluble in water and is widely utilized to stabilize the pH of various biological systems.
